Indonesian vs Serbian 3 or more Vehicles in Household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 162,622,478 people shows a poor positive correlation between the proportion of Indonesians and percentage of households with 3 or more vehicles available in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.135 and weighted average of 18.3%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 267,464,663 people shows no correlation between the proportion of Serbians and percentage of households with 3 or more vehicles available in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.037 and weighted average of 19.1%, a difference of 4.4%.
